.print-layout_printRoot__aeghE{--page-width:8.5in;--page-height:11in;--page-padding:0.5in;--page-content-width:calc(var(--page-width) - (2 * var(--page-padding)));--page-content-height:calc(var(--page-height) - (2 * var(--page-padding)));--page-header-height:0in;--grid-gap:0.2in;--section-gap:0.16in;--preview-scale:1;color:#111827;font-family:var(--font-sans,system-ui,-apple-system,BlinkMacSystemFont,"Helvetica Neue",Helvetica,Arial,sans-serif)}.print-layout_screenOnly__KY6sr{display:block}.print-layout_printOnly__KCV_s{display:none}.print-layout_previewStack__feeR8{display:flex;flex-direction:column;gap:24px;align-items:flex-start}.print-layout_previewPage__m_NIX{width:calc(var(--page-width) * var(--preview-scale));height:calc(var(--page-height) * var(--preview-scale))}.print-layout_previewPageInner__OzQi_{width:var(--page-width);height:var(--page-height);transform:scale(var(--preview-scale));transform-origin:top left}.print-layout_page__nCDTh{box-sizing:border-box;width:var(--page-width);height:var(--page-height);padding:var(--page-padding);background:#ffffff;border:1px solid #e5e7eb;border-radius:12px;box-shadow:0 12px 30px rgba(15,23,42,.14);display:flex;flex-direction:column;gap:var(--section-gap)}.print-layout_pageHeader__SVjyB{height:var(--page-header-height);display:flex;flex-direction:column;justify-content:center;gap:.05in;min-height:0}.print-layout_pageTitle__JA98M{font-size:14pt;font-weight:600;line-height:1.1;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.print-layout_pageSubtitle__Xo_zJ{font-size:9pt;color:#6b7280;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.print-layout_pageGrid__RAnuu{flex:1 1 auto;min-height:0;display:grid;gap:var(--grid-gap)}.print-layout_gridStandard__0Fx8I{grid-template-columns:repeat(2,1fr)}.print-layout_gridCompact__Cmd6K,.print-layout_gridStandard__0Fx8I{grid-auto-rows:calc((var(--page-content-height) - var(--page-header-height) - var(--section-gap) - var(--grid-gap)) / 2)}.print-layout_gridCompact__Cmd6K{grid-template-columns:repeat(3,1fr)}.print-layout_gridSingle__G4tnd{grid-template-columns:1fr;grid-auto-rows:calc(var(--page-content-height) - var(--page-header-height) - var(--section-gap))}.print-layout_card___aisp{border:1px solid #e5e7eb;border-radius:10px;padding:.12in;display:flex;flex-direction:column;gap:.08in;background:#ffffff;min-height:0}.print-layout_cardStandard__knJRY{--card-header-height:0.55in;--legend-height:0.95in;--legend-font:7pt;--title-font:11pt;--subtitle-font:7.5pt}.print-layout_cardCompact__LTSKz{--card-header-height:0.45in;--legend-height:0.7in;--legend-font:6.5pt;--title-font:10pt;--subtitle-font:7pt}.print-layout_cardSingle__R3iKL{--card-header-height:0.7in;--legend-height:1.1in;--legend-font:8pt;--title-font:14pt;--subtitle-font:9pt}.print-layout_cardHeader__DkiGd{height:var(--card-header-height);display:flex;flex-direction:column;justify-content:center;gap:.04in;border-bottom:1px solid #f1f5f9;padding-bottom:.06in}.print-layout_cardTitle__96odk{font-size:var(--title-font);font-weight:600;color:#111827;text-align:center;line-height:1.1}.print-layout_cardMeta__FiXXG{font-size:var(--subtitle-font);color:#6b7280;text-align:center;line-height:1.1}.print-layout_cardTeam__VGXRg{font-size:var(--subtitle-font);color:#ea580c;text-align:center;font-weight:600}.print-layout_courtWrap__ohjCi{flex:1 1 auto;min-height:0}.print-layout_courtSvg__bs0UI{width:100%;height:100%;display:block}.print-layout_legend__KYDGd{height:var(--legend-height);border-top:1px solid #f1f5f9;padding-top:.06in;overflow:hidden}.print-layout_legendGrid__qdELE{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));grid-auto-rows:1fr;gap:.04in .08in;font-size:var(--legend-font);color:#4b5563;height:100%}.print-layout_legendRow__HT6Hd{display:grid;grid-template-columns:.12in auto auto 1fr;align-items:center;gap:.05in;min-width:0}.print-layout_legendDot__x4ToS{width:.12in;height:.12in;border-radius:999px}.print-layout_legendRole__xLQlW{font-weight:600;color:#374151}.print-layout_legendNumber__PhHQP{color:#6b7280}.print-layout_legendName__d0kg8{min-width:0;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;color:#4b5563}@media print{@page{size:letter;margin:0}.print-layout_printRoot__aeghE{background:#ffffff;color:#111827}.print-layout_printRoot__aeghE,.print-layout_printRoot__aeghE *{-webkit-print-color-adjust:exact;print-color-adjust:exact}.print-layout_previewStack__feeR8{gap:0}.print-layout_previewPage__m_NIX{width:var(--page-width);height:var(--page-height)}.print-layout_previewPageInner__OzQi_{transform:none}.print-layout_screenOnly__KY6sr{display:none}.print-layout_printOnly__KCV_s{display:block}.print-layout_page__nCDTh{border:none;border-radius:0;box-shadow:none;break-after:page;page-break-after:always}.print-layout_page__nCDTh:last-child{break-after:auto;page-break-after:auto}}